For those unfamiliar with Consonance, they are fast becoming known as one of the "high end" manufacturers from the Orient, and are responsible for the Consonance Droplet and Linear CDPs which have developed almost cult status since their launch. Indeed, I have a Droplet CDP and wouldn't part with it for any other disc spinner at any price.
This amplifier is the highly reviewed 2A3 push-pull amp, using a quad of 2A3 triodes to deliver 11.5w/ch, a choked power supply with huge transformers, the fabulous 6SN7 as a phase splitter/driver (one per channel) and 12ax7's in the gain stage. Ignore the modest output as this amp has more grunt than the figures would suggest and in push-pull mode, this amp will drive the most difficult of loads (I've seen it used to drive electrostatics with ease). It has more headroom, punch and slam than any SET amp I've heard, so the push-pull configuration with the 2A3's is a stroke of genius really. It retains that unique sound purity of 300B/2A3 valves but delivers more power than either valves in single ended mode.
